Here is a list of wedding flowers pink and their season:

Spring – flowers pink wedding flowers or most are widely available this season. Specifications pink flowers in spring are the anemone, peony, star Gazer lily, sweet pea and tulips.

Summer – A summer wedding flowers pink as such offers the chrysanthemum, Freesia, Gerbera daisy, hydrangea, Larkspur and more.

Autumn – pink flowers for fall include Aster, dahlia and zinnia.

Winter – Winter can produce pink color selections such as the anemone, cosmos, camellias and ranunculus.
